VentriPoint Diagnostics Ltd V.VPT

Alternate Symbol(s):  VPTDF

Ventripoint Diagnostics Ltd is a Canada-based medical device company. The Company is engaged in the development and commercialization of diagnostic tools that monitor patients with heart disease. It is developing a suite of applications for all heart diseases and imaging modalities, including congenital heart disease, pregnancy, pulmonary hypertension, COVID-19, imaging, and cardiotoxicity in oncology patients. The Company’s Ventripoint Medical System (VMS+) is a diagnostic aid that was developed to provide a point-of-care solution to better communicate the heart’s structure and function without the need for magnetic resonance imaging (MRI). VMS+ enhances ultrasound, providing three-dimensional (3D) technology that allows for visualization of all four chambers of the heart. The system’s proprietary Knowledge Based Reconstruction (KBR) technology creates 3D models of the heart and calculates volumes and ejection fractions equivalent to the gold-standard Magnetic resonance imaging (MRI).
